As a teacher in an inner-city school, Lucy Crehan was exasperated with ever-changing government policy claiming to be based on lessons from `top-performing` education systems. She resolved to find out what was really going on in the classrooms of countries whose teenagers ranked top in the world in reading, maths & science. Cleverlands documents Crehan`s journey around the world, weaving together her experiences with research on policy, history, psychology & culture to offer extensive new insights into what we can learn from these countries.
